Trends in networks: Connecting to the Internet of Things
Back in 1982, General Motors demanded that all automation control suppliers develop a communication standard that would let the automaker gather data easily from all its machines. This attempt was known as the Manufacturing Automation Protocol (MAP) and it was a huge failure. The controls vendors did not cooperate, resulting in a seven-layer monster that […]
EtherCAT’s EK18xx coupler series integrates digital I/Os
EtherCAT’s (www.ethercat.org) EK18xx coupler series efficiently integrates important functionalities of the EK1100 EtherCAT coupler and the standard digital Input/Outputs in just a single housing. The result is a compact design which has the dimensions of minimally 44x100x68 mm especially suitable for applications whose number of I/Os are relatively smaller.
